POSITION ADJUSTING DEVICE, SHOOTING GAME DEVICE USING THE SAME AND SHOOTING METHOD THEREOF
A firing device includes a magazine configured to receive a plurality of toy bullets and a turret connected with the magazine. A bottom plate of the magazine is provided with a bullet output port. The turret includes a conduit, a barrel aligned with the conduit, and a propelling device disposed between the conduit and the barrel. The conduit is disposed below the magazine and is provided with a guide slot including a bullet inlet substantially aligned with the bullet output port of the magazine.

Position adjusting device, shooting game device using the same and shooting method thereof
A position adjusting device includes a first support member, a yaw axis motor disposed on the first support member, a second support member rotatably disposed on the first support member through the yaw axis motor, and a pitch axis motor disposed on the second support member and used for driving the load to rotate. The yaw axis motor is used for driving the second support member to rotate about a yaw axis to cause the load to rotate about the yaw axis. The pitch axis motor is used for driving the load to rotate about a pitch axis.
